Event Description

The Grand Slam Challenge is a series of recreational rides catering to cyclists of differing abilities looking to share the experience with hundreds of like-minded riders.

Between February and October there are five Grand Slam Challenge rides throughout the Adelaide Hills, Barossa Valley and Fleurieu Peninsula as part of the Grand Slam Challenge Series. Participants can ride in one, two, three, four or all five of the rides.

Each ride combines two different loops of between 40km and 100km, all starting an

d finishing in the one location. There is also a Mini Slam for those looking for something a little less challenging, in which participants complete only one of the two loops.

#1 Mt Torrens - 17 February - 40km/80km
#2 Willunga - 14 April - 50km/100km
#3 Meadows - 2 June - 60km/120km
#4 Strathalbyn - 25 August - 75km/150km
#5 Mt. Pleasant - 13 October - 100km/200km
